/* View/edit this file with tab stops set to 4 */

#ifdef HAVE_XORG_CONFIG_H
#include <xorg-config.h>
#endif

#include "xf86Parser.h"
#include "xf86tokens.h"
#include "Configint.h"

extern LexRec val;

static xf86ConfigSymTabRec SubModuleTab[] =
{
	{ENDSUBSECTION, "endsubsection"},
	{OPTION, "option"},
	{-1, ""},
};

static xf86ConfigSymTabRec ModuleTab[] =
{
	{ENDSECTION, "endsection"},
	{LOAD, "load"},
    {DISABLE, "disable"}, 
	{LOAD_DRIVER, "loaddriver"},
	{SUBSECTION, "subsection"},
	{-1, ""},
};

#define CLEANUP xf86freeModules

static XF86LoadPtr
xf86parseModuleSubSection (XF86LoadPtr head, char *name)
{
	int token;
	parsePrologue (XF86LoadPtr, XF86LoadRec)

	ptr->load_name = name;
	ptr->load_type = XF86_LOAD_MODULE;
        ptr->ignore    = 0;
	ptr->load_opt  = NULL;
	ptr->list.next = NULL;

	while ((token = xf86getToken (SubModuleTab)) != ENDSUBSECTION)
	{
		switch (token)
		{
		case COMMENT:
			ptr->load_comment = xf86addComment(ptr->load_comment, val.str);
			break;
		case OPTION:
			ptr->load_opt = xf86parseOption(ptr->load_opt);
			break;
		case EOF_TOKEN:
			xf86parseError (UNEXPECTED_EOF_MSG, NULL);
			xf86conffree(ptr);
			return NULL;
		default:
			xf86parseError (INVALID_KEYWORD_MSG, xf86tokenString ());
			xf86conffree(ptr);
			return NULL;
			break;
		}

	}

	return ((XF86LoadPtr) xf86addListItem ((glp) head, (glp) ptr));
}

XF86ConfModulePtr
xf86parseModuleSection (void)
{
	int token;
	parsePrologue (XF86ConfModulePtr, XF86ConfModuleRec)

	while ((token = xf86getToken (ModuleTab)) != ENDSECTION)
	{
		switch (token)
		{
		case COMMENT:
			ptr->mod_comment = xf86addComment(ptr->mod_comment, val.str);
			break;
		case LOAD:
			if (xf86getSubToken (&(ptr->mod_comment)) != STRING)
				Error (QUOTE_MSG, "Load");
			ptr->mod_load_lst =
				xf86addNewLoadDirective (ptr->mod_load_lst, val.str,
									 XF86_LOAD_MODULE, NULL);
			break;
		case DISABLE:
			if (xf86getSubToken (&(ptr->mod_comment)) != STRING)
				Error (QUOTE_MSG, "Disable");
			ptr->mod_disable_lst =
				xf86addNewLoadDirective (ptr->mod_disable_lst, val.str,
									 XF86_DISABLE_MODULE, NULL);
			break;
		case LOAD_DRIVER:
			if (xf86getSubToken (&(ptr->mod_comment)) != STRING)
				Error (QUOTE_MSG, "LoadDriver");
			ptr->mod_load_lst =
				xf86addNewLoadDirective (ptr->mod_load_lst, val.str,
									 XF86_LOAD_DRIVER, NULL);
			break;
		case SUBSECTION:
			if (xf86getSubToken (&(ptr->mod_comment)) != STRING)
						Error (QUOTE_MSG, "SubSection");
			ptr->mod_load_lst =
				xf86parseModuleSubSection (ptr->mod_load_lst, val.str);
			break;
		case EOF_TOKEN:
			Error (UNEXPECTED_EOF_MSG, NULL);
			break;
		default:
			Error (INVALID_KEYWORD_MSG, xf86tokenString ());
			break;
		}
	}

#ifdef DEBUG
	printf ("Module section parsed\n");
#endif

	return ptr;
}

#undef CLEANUP

void
xf86printModuleSection (FILE * cf, XF86ConfModulePtr ptr)
{
	XF86LoadPtr lptr;

	if (ptr == NULL)
		return;

	if (ptr->mod_comment)
		fprintf(cf, "%s", ptr->mod_comment);
	for (lptr = ptr->mod_load_lst; lptr; lptr = lptr->list.next)
	{
		switch (lptr->load_type)
		{
		case XF86_LOAD_MODULE:
			if( lptr->load_opt == NULL ) {
				fprintf (cf, "\tLoad  \"%s\"", lptr->load_name);
				if (lptr->load_comment)
					fprintf(cf, "%s", lptr->load_comment);
				else
					fputc('\n', cf);
			}
			else
			{
				fprintf (cf, "\tSubSection \"%s\"\n", lptr->load_name);
				if (lptr->load_comment)
					fprintf(cf, "%s", lptr->load_comment);
				xf86printOptionList(cf, lptr->load_opt, 2);
				fprintf (cf, "\tEndSubSection\n");
			}
			break;
		case XF86_LOAD_DRIVER:
			fprintf (cf, "\tLoadDriver  \"%s\"", lptr->load_name);
				if (lptr->load_comment)
					fprintf(cf, "%s", lptr->load_comment);
				else
					fputc('\n', cf);
			break;
#if 0
		default:
			fprintf (cf, "#\tUnknown type  \"%s\"\n", lptr->load_name);
			break;
#endif
		}
	}
}

XF86LoadPtr
xf86addNewLoadDirective (XF86LoadPtr head, char *name, int type, XF86OptionPtr opts)
{
	XF86LoadPtr new;
	int token;

	new = xf86confcalloc (1, sizeof (XF86LoadRec));
	new->load_name = name;
	new->load_type = type;
	new->load_opt  = opts;
        new->ignore    = 0;
	new->list.next = NULL;

	if ((token = xf86getToken(NULL)) == COMMENT)
		new->load_comment = xf86addComment(new->load_comment, val.str);
	else
		xf86unGetToken(token);

	return ((XF86LoadPtr) xf86addListItem ((glp) head, (glp) new));
}

void
xf86freeModules (XF86ConfModulePtr ptr)
{
	XF86LoadPtr lptr;
	XF86LoadPtr prev;

	if (ptr == NULL)
		return;
	lptr = ptr->mod_load_lst;
	while (lptr)
	{
		TestFree (lptr->load_name);
		TestFree (lptr->load_comment);
		prev = lptr;
		lptr = lptr->list.next;
		xf86conffree (prev);
	}
	lptr = ptr->mod_disable_lst;
	while (lptr)
	{
		TestFree (lptr->load_name);
		TestFree (lptr->load_comment);
		prev = lptr;
		lptr = lptr->list.next;
		xf86conffree (prev);
	}
	TestFree (ptr->mod_comment);
	xf86conffree (ptr);
}
